Purpose:

Provides piano accompaniment for choral groups, soloists, recitals, concerts, and other special events as needed/scheduled.

Essential Job Duties:

  • Plays accompaniment at sight for designated classes, choral groups, and other performances.
  • Assists students or instructors in planning, reviewing, and selecting music suitable to various occasions.
  • May adapt themes to the piano from recorded music.
  • May accompany students in performances.
  • Performs related duties as assigned.

Knowledge Skills Abilities:

  • Knowledge of advanced piano playing.
  • Knowledge of music theory, harmony, rhythm, composition, and transposition.
  • Knowledge of the meaning of musical terms, signs, and abbreviations.
  • Knowledge of vocal techniques.
  • Ability to play at sight, with accuracy and feeling.
  • Ability to memorize, improvise, adapt and transpose music.
  • Ability to coach students individually or in small groups to improve vocal and/or instrumental skills.
  • Ability to follow a soloist or a conductor in performing a musical score.
  • Ability to understand and carry out oral and written instructions.
  • Ability to read, write and speak English fluently.
  • Ability to independently prioritize work and adjust time schedule.
  • Ability to adapt to changing work priorities.
  • Ability to effectively communicate with diverse groups, students, parents, staff and establish and maintain effective relationships.
  • Ability to maintain confidentiality and use discretion related to employment and student matters.
  • Ability to manage time and responsibilities and adapt to changing work priorities.
  • Ability to perform duties with awareness of all District requirements and Board policies.
  • Skill in adhering to safety practices.
